Overview
The Build Loop pattern enables continuous, autonomous website development through a "baton" system.
Each iteration:
- Read current task from baton file (
next-prompt.md) - Generate page using Stitch MCP tools
- Integrate page into site structure
- Write next task to baton file for next iteration

Execution Protocol
Step 1: Read the Baton
Parse next-prompt.md to extract:
- Page name from the
pagefrontmatter field - Prompt content from the markdown body
Step 2: Reference Context Files
Before generation, read these files:
| File | Purpose |
|---|---|
SITE.md |
Site vision, Stitch Project ID, existing pages (sitemap), roadmap |
DESIGN.md |
Visual style needed for Stitch prompts |
Important checks:
- Section 4 (Sitemap) -- do not recreate pages that already exist
- Section 5 (Roadmap) -- if there's a backlog, select tasks from here
- Section 6 (Creative Freedom) -- if roadmap is empty, new page ideas
Step 3: Generate with Stitch
Use Stitch MCP tools to generate the page.
Step 4: Integrate into Site
- Move generated HTML from
queue/{page}.htmltosite/public/{page}.html - Fix asset paths to be relative to the public folder
- Update navigation:
- Connect existing placeholder links (e.g.,
href="#") to new page - Add new page to global navigation where appropriate
- Connect existing placeholder links (e.g.,
- Ensure consistent header/footer across all pages
Step 5: Update Site Documentation
Modify SITE.md:
- Mark new page as
[x]in Section 4 (Sitemap) - Remove used ideas from Section 6 (Creative Freedom)
- Update Section 5 (Roadmap) when backlog items are completed
Step 6: Prepare Next Baton (Important!)
You MUST update next-prompt.md before completing. This maintains the loop.
File Structure Reference
project/
├── next-prompt.md # Baton -- current task
├── stitch.json # Stitch project ID (must preserve!)
├── DESIGN.md # Visual design system (from design-md skill)
├── SITE.md # Site vision, sitemap, roadmap
├── queue/ # Stitch output staging area
│ ├── {page}.html
│ └── {page}.png
└── site/public/ # Production pages
├── index.html
└── {page}.html
